Output d500ca90ae4dfac9f907e0a2bcd64a70300fa8e364b2d64ea055cf4f916b9117:2

value
2258460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f1a65d7ef5455d76b2975549811fb23e2fd5de5 OP_EQUAL
address
3EjgB8Qvws6UKakm97XaTcmSnmVFksu1i1
transaction
d500ca90ae4dfac9f907e0a2bcd64a70300fa8e364b2d64ea055cf4f916b9117
confirmations
110663
spent
true